The name Pimitivo is derived from the Latin 'primitivus,' meaning 'first' or 'original.' Historically, it was used to denote the firstborn son or someone considered ancient or original in lineage. The name carries connotations of nobility, tradition, and foundational importance within a family or community, rooted in classical Latin naming traditions.

Cultural Significance of Pimitivo

Pimitivo has strong roots in Latin culture where the firstborn son often held a position of honor and responsibility. In ancient Roman families, names related to birth order carried weight and were connected to inheritance and family legacy. Though rare today, Pimitivo evokes a sense of tradition, respect for ancestry, and the importance of beginnings within a lineage, reflecting a deep cultural reverence for family history.

Fun Fact About Pimitivo

The name Pimitivo is closely related to 'Primitivo,' which is also a popular grape variety used in winemaking, especially in Southern Italy, linking the name to rich cultural traditions beyond just naming.
